(35,992 posts)4. This one isn't what it seems
Indigo Farms has donated a massive amount of blueberries to food banks this year.
The flyer was altered when it was posted on Tik Tok.
Yeah I know it's 101.5 and they suck but still:
https://nj1015.com/nj-farm-donates-blueberry-crop/
"Indigo Farms of NJ is a regenerative organic blueberry farm in the State of NJ in its ninth harvest season, it is imperative to prune plants based on our growing method," Bohlin said in a written statement on Monday.
"To be clear, our farm utilizes the federal program, H2A to source labor and have not been impacted by migrant labor shortages whatsoever," Bohlin said, adding the farm does everything "by the book" and is a proud participant in the federal program that allows for legal seasonal hiring of American workers.

Bohlin and her sons had the idea to help locals in a pruning year, as plants are trimmed back every 8 to 10 years, for maximum crop health.
Realistically, it's a combination of market pricing, necessary pruning timing that has pushed us in the direction of being focused towards volunteering/donations this year as opposed to a commercial harvest, Director of Operations Brian Bohlin said in an email to New Jersey 101.5.
